Do Quantum Dots or Quantum Wire Based Devices Offer a Practical Advantage in Producing Semiconductor Optical Amplifiers over Conventional 2-D Active Media?

Not Accessible

Your library or personal account may give you access

Abstract

Basic properties of nano-structure semiconductor gain media such as an inhomogeneously broadened gain, a fast response time, a low a-parameter and complex carrier dynamics yield amplifiers which are far superior to conventional quantum well amplifiers.
